Proclamation auctioned off for €124k
The lot, described by Adams Auctioneers as “an original copy of the foundation document of modern Irish nationhood” had gone under the hammer with a guide price of €60,000-€80,000 but sold to a private bidder for €124,000.
It had been preserved by a Co Longford family “with Republican affiliations”. Original copies of the Proclamation have always been scarce, according to Adams Auctioneers.
